  • J. C. McLaren noted “Cramps or spasms beginning in hands and feet, extending to belly.” Guernsey said that “a slimy metallic taste in the mouth” is one of the strongest indications for Cupr.

  • Mossa regarded Cupr as one of the rem edies for the effects of fright, and relates the case of a girl who after a fright was affected by involuntary motions of left arm and leg developing into pronounced general chorea.
  • Cupr brought about slow but decided recovery.
  • Another girl, 12, who had recovered from whooping cough got a kind of chorea from repeated frights on seeing an epileptic.
  • To the muscular movements was added silly behavior including a heavy tongue, slow speech and unwieldy gait.
  • Frightened at night.
  • Greediness in eating and drinking.
  • Ign., Stram., Sulph., did little good.
  • She became ill-natured.
  • Cupr every four days cured completely in three months.
  • Mackechnie reported the case of a boy who became epileptic after being locked up in school.
  • Very great improvementfollowed the administration of Cupr.
  • Schwencke cured a case of epilepsy of forty years' standing with Cupr.
  • 6c after Bell, and Hyos had done little good.
  • The patient was a man aged 45.
  • The fits began suddenly towards morning with chewing motion of lower jaw, gnashing of teeth, becomes upright and rigid in bed, shrieks, limbs convulsed.
  • After giving way to violent anger, attacks become more severe, arms and legs were thrown outwards and trunk arched upward.
  • Cupr was given.
  • For a time the attacks con tinued, but gradually improvement set in and in less than three months they ceased altogether.
  • The “anger” in this case and the “ill-humor” in Mossa's are noteworthy as maliciousness is an indication for Cupr.
  • In a second case cured by Schwencke, that of a man, 38, epileptic seven years, a pressive headache preceded the attacks, ascending from nape to forehead, then there was profuse salivation, head turned to left, eyes closed tongue in active motion in open mouth, trunk arched upward, slight spasms of rig ht arm outward.
  • After the attack, there was a dullness in the head and a feeling in the body as if beaten.
  • Cupr first removed the fits and then the dullness of the head.
